tests/TestQualityManager.py

@@ -0,0 +1,60 @@
+from unittest.mock import MagicMock
+
+import pytest
+
+from cura.Machines.QualityManager import QualityManager
+
+
+
+mocked_stack = MagicMock()
+mocked_extruder = MagicMock()
+
+mocked_material = MagicMock()
+mocked_material.getMetaDataEntry = MagicMock(return_value = "base_material")
+
+mocked_extruder.material = mocked_material
+mocked_stack.extruders = {"0": mocked_extruder}
+
+@pytest.fixture()
+def material_manager():
+    result = MagicMock()
+    result.getRootMaterialIDWithoutDiameter = MagicMock(return_value = "base_material")
+    return result
+
+@pytest.fixture()
+def container_registry():
+    result = MagicMock()
+    mocked_metadata = [{"id": "test", "definition": "fdmprinter", "quality_type": "normal", "name": "test_name", "global_quality": True, "type": "quality"},
+                       {"id": "test_material", "definition": "fdmprinter", "quality_type": "normal", "name": "test_name_material", "material": "base_material", "type": "quality"},
+                       {"id": "quality_changes_id", "definition": "fdmprinter", "type": "quality_changes", "quality_type": "amazing!", "name": "herp"}]
+    result.findContainersMetadata = MagicMock(return_value = mocked_metadata)
+    return result
+
+
+@pytest.fixture()
+def quality_mocked_application(material_manager, container_registry):
+    result = MagicMock()
+    result.getMaterialManager = MagicMock(return_value=material_manager)
+    result.getContainerRegistry = MagicMock(return_value=container_registry)
+    return result
+
+
+def test_getQualityGroups(quality_mocked_application):
+    manager = QualityManager(quality_mocked_application)
+    manager.initialize()
+
+    assert "normal" in manager.getQualityGroups(mocked_stack)
+
+
+def test_getQualityGroupsForMachineDefinition(quality_mocked_application):
+    manager = QualityManager(quality_mocked_application)
+    manager.initialize()
+
+    assert "normal" in manager.getQualityGroupsForMachineDefinition(mocked_stack)
+
+
+def test_getQualityChangesGroup(quality_mocked_application):
+    manager = QualityManager(quality_mocked_application)
+    manager.initialize()
+
+    assert "herp" in manager.getQualityChangesGroups(mocked_stack)
